The above observations do not allow a clear-cut interpretation of the mechanism of the reaction of 1 with nucleophiles. It is clear that anions of compounds with pK,> 19 (acetophenone, acetonitrile, dithiane) do not react successfully with 1, whereas anions derived from less basic substrates (pK,< 131, such as keto esters and malonates, give excellent yields of displacement products.
